A leading delivery service company in Greater Manchester is seeking a Junior Operations Supervisor to oversee the warehouse operations. The role involves team leadership, ensuring high operational standards, and managing stock and delivery processes.
Ideal candidates should have a background in restaurant, retail, or warehouse environments, alongside strong communication skills. The company offers a supportive workplace and flexibility in scheduling.

How to prepare for a job interview at Gopuff
✨Know the Company Inside Out
Before your interview, do some digging into the delivery service company. Understand their values, mission, and what sets them apart in the industry. This will not only help you answer questions more effectively but also show that you're genuinely interested in being part of their team.
✨Showcase Your Leadership Skills
As a Warehouse Shift Lead, you'll need to demonstrate your ability to lead a team. Prepare examples from your past experiences in restaurant, retail, or warehouse settings where you've successfully managed a team or improved operational standards. Be ready to discuss how you motivate others and handle challenges.
✨Communicate Clearly and Confidently
Strong communication skills are key for this role. Practice articulating your thoughts clearly and confidently. You might want to rehearse common interview questions with a friend or in front of a mirror. Remember, it's not just about what you say, but how you say it!
✨Ask Insightful Questions
At the end of the interview, when they ask if you have any questions, don’t just say no! Prepare thoughtful questions about the company's operations, team dynamics, or future goals. This shows your enthusiasm for the role and helps you gauge if the company is the right fit for you.
